Pakistani Scholar wins International Chemistry Award

Pakistani Scholar, Dr. Hina Siddiqui, the winner of the best “Oral Presentation Award” in the 11th Eurasia conference on Chemical Sciences, could be an example for many Pakistani women who are striving hard to achieve their goals in life.

NTC opts for SAP Technology Implementation

NTC and Siemens Pakistan have entered into a technology agreement according to which SAP would be licensing its ERP software solution at NTC. The solution will be implemented at NTC through Siemens Pakistan, which is one of SAP’s top implementation partners in Pakistan.
